About this program

The BA International Management Studies in the Baltic Sea Region (BMS) at Stralsund University of Applied Sciences is designed to equip students with essential knowledge and practical skills in the realm of international business. This programme spans over 8 semesters, blending theoretical insights with hands-on experiences, making it ideal for those aspiring to operate in the global marketplace. Students will delve into modules that cover various aspects of international management, cross-cultural communication, and regional economic dynamics, particularly focusing on the Baltic Sea area.

As a student in this Bachelor's programme, you will experience a well-structured academic journey that typically includes both compulsory and elective modules, culminating in a thesis. The inclusion of an internship or practical semester further allows you to gain valuable on-the-ground experience, bridging the gap between academic concepts and real-world applications. This practical component not only enhances your employability but also provides a platform to network with industry professionals.

The skills developed throughout the course encompass critical thinking, strategic management, and intercultural competence, which are vital in today's interconnected business environment. The programme is particularly suited for individuals who are motivated by challenges in international business settings and who wish to understand the complexities of operating in diverse cultural and economic landscapes.

Entry requirements

English: Taught in English.
International students: Non-EU applicants need a German national student visa (Visa D) and proof of funds (usually a blocked account). Check the programme page for the exact language certificate and document list.

Career outcomes

  • International Business Consultant
  • Marketing Manager in multinational companies
  • Trade Analyst for government or private sector
  • Project Manager for international ventures
  • Export Coordinator in shipping or logistics

The demand for graduates with a solid understanding of international business is significant in Germany, especially within its thriving Mittelstand (small and medium-sized enterprises) as well as large multinational corporations. With Germany being a central hub in Europe for trade and commerce, professionals equipped with international management skills are sought after in various industries.
